Leasehold Terms. If this Security Instrument is on a leasehold, Borrower will comply with all the provisions of the lease. If Xxxxxxxx acquires fee title to the Property, the leasehold and the fee title will not merge unless Xxxxxx agrees to the merger in writing.

Leasehold Terms. If I do not own but am a tenant on the Property, I will fulfill all my obligations under my lease. I also agree that, if I subsequently purchase or otherwise become the owner of the Property, my interest as the tenant and my interest as the owner will remain separate unless Xxxxxx agrees to the merger in writing.

Leasehold Terms. We are instructed to market for sale our clients long leasehold interest. The leasehold is for a period of 150 years running from 27th July 2015 until 26th July 2165. The current passing rent is £484,950 pa with the next rent review due 27/07/2025 (5 yearly). Full details of leasehold available on request. This consent has been extended through emergency Coronavirus Planning Regulations and remains extant until 31st March 2023. In 2021 Formal Investments acquired interest from a retail occupier with specific occupational requirements. Given the lack of an original decision notice for the building pre-dating BHS occupation, for good practice Formal Investments applied for Class 1 use to ascertain fresh certainty on matters related to use, hours of occupation, servicing etc. This application (Planning App No:21/00612/FUL) was consented on 4th June 2021. In terms of future development, the site is a key regeneration opportunity and will be suitable for a variety of uses. The reimagination of Sauchiehall Street remains a priority for Glasgow City Council, who will be keen to engage positively.   • New Lease In the event of the termination of this Lease as a result of Tenant's default prior to the expiration of the term, or in the event of a rejection by Landlord or Tenant of this Lease under Chapter 11 of the Bankruptcy Code, Landlord shall, in addition to providing the notices of default and termination as required by this Lease, provide each Leasehold Mortgagee with written notice that the Lease has been terminated or that Landlord has filed a request with the Bankruptcy Court seeking to reject the Lease, together with a statement of all sums which would at that time be due under this Lease but for such termination or rejection, and of all other defaults, if any, then known to Landlord. Upon any request of the Leasehold Mortgagee, or its designee, Landlord agrees to enter into a new lease ("New Lease") of the Premises with such Leasehold Mortgagee or its designee for the remainder of the term of this Lease, effective as of the date of termination or rejection, as the case may be, at the Rent, and upon the terms, covenants and conditions (including all transfer rights, but excluding requirements which are not applicable or which have already been fulfilled) of this Lease; provided, however, that (i) the Leasehold Mortgagee whose lien upon the Premises is superior to the lien of any other Leasehold Mortgage (the "Senior Leasehold Mortgagee") shall have the right to give notice of its intent to enter into a New Lease to the Landlord for a period of 60 days from its receipt of the notice referred to in the first sentence of this Section 18.2.18 and (ii) if the Senior Leasehold Mortgagee does not exercise its right to enter into the New Lease during this 60-day period; the Leasehold Mortgagee whose lien upon the Premises is superior to the lien of any other Leasehold Mortgage (other than the Senior Leasehold Mortgagee) shall have the right to give notice of its intent to enter into a New Lease to the Landlord during the remainder of the period(s) specified below; and provided further, however,
